Sudan Loses Millions of Dollars Annually Due to Wasted Animal Hides

Khartoum – Mashawir

Sudan’s Minister of Animal Resources and Fisheries, Ahmed Al-Tijani Al-Mansouri, revealed on Thursday that the country loses annually due to the waste of animal hides. He announced a comprehensive plan to develop the sector and transform it into a value-added export resource.

Speaking at a workshop on preventing the waste of sacrificial animal hides in the capital, Khartoum, Al-Mansouri pointed to significant negligence in handling hides and poor utilization, which has led to major economic losses alongside environmental damage caused by waste.

He explained that the leather sector represents an important economic resource, as it is one of the key contributors to generating foreign currency for the

Al-Mansouri stated that the ministry’s strategic plan includes around 40 projects, with a large portion dedicated to the leather sector. The goal is to transform it from a wasted resource into a strategic export industry by focusing on manufacturing rather than exporting raw materials, establishing specialized markets, and forming partnerships with international expertise firms to market leather products.

He also highlighted coordination with the Ministry of Industry and Trade to rehabilitate meat and livestock product factories and develop the sector, in addition to plans to partner with global fashion houses to maximize added value.
